Octavian - The New Gaius Julius Caesar

Historians label the new gaius julius caesar octavian through this period, simply to avoid confusing him with his dead uncle. After the triumph over marcantony, we call him augustus, a title conferred on him by the senate in 27 b c. Octavian was hailed by caesar's legions in brundicium as their rightful new leader,. much to the chagrin of antony.
